CNN anchor Jake Tapper recently issued a public apology to Lara Trump, acknowledging she was correct in her 2020 assessment of then-candidate Joe Biden’s cognitive decline. Tapper’s admission comes as he promotes his new book, Original Sin: President Biden’s Decline, Its Cover-Up, and His Disastrous Choice to Run Again, which details alleged efforts by Biden’s team to conceal his deteriorating health.
In a 2020 interview, Tapper dismissed Lara Trump’s concerns about Biden’s mental acuity, accusing her of mocking his stutter. However, during a recent appearance on The Megyn Kelly Show, Tapper conceded, “She saw something that I did not see at the time, 100 percent.”
Lara Trump confirmed that Tapper called her two months prior to the book’s release to apologize and inform her of his intention to publicly acknowledge his error. While she appreciated the gesture, she remarked, “The damage is done… it feels a little bit too late to me.”
Tapper’s delayed acknowledgment has sparked criticism from both sides of the political spectrum. Conservatives argue that his initial dismissal contributed to a media cover-up of Biden’s health issues, while some liberals accuse Tapper of pandering to Trump supporters to boost book sales.
